Jerry Kranitz, AURAL INNOVATIONS, April 2004

'Daughter of God', self released 2004.
Multi-instrumentalist Chris Snidow has been playing music since the late 1960’s, having been based through the years in Texas, California, Holland, France and northern Africa. He has played various styles of music and has been in bands that have opened for the likes of Ike and Tina Turner, Sonny & Cher, The Mothers of Invention, Chuck Berry and the Nitty Gritty Dirt Band. 'Daughter of God', Joan of Arc is Snidow’s third CD…Snidow does an outstanding job of bringing the story of the remarkable woman to life with music that is spiritually uplifting, including powerful melodies that often reach peaks of full symphonic majesty. Snidow also injects elements of ambient space into the mix which gives things a nice cosmic kick…Snidow is such an accomplished musical storyteller that while the music certainly stands on its own merits, following the narration made for a much fuller immersion in the story and conjured up vivid images of the unfolding events. An impressive effort and one that can be enjoyed with eyes closed under the headphones for more actively following the story.
